By using a Virtual CAN Bus, we separate the control task from other tasks. The distributed embedded control system can be developed using standard CAN Controllers and transceivers in a traditional way with well proven tools.
Other tasks such as encryption, transmitter authentication, re-flashing, etc. can be developed by experts in these fields and carried out by using other protocols. With modern technology, the different tasks can run in parallel and simultaneously communicate on the same physical layer.
It is a great advantage to separate the control problems from other problems. The control problem can be solved once and for all by the control experts and other problems by experts in their respective technology fields.
The Kvaser U100-X2 is a robust, galvanically-reinforced single-channel CAN/CAN FD to USB interface with a 5-pole M12 connector.
Signal and power isolated, the Kvaser U100 offers enhanced electrical protection, a vibration, shock and drop-proof housing and high-quality cabling that meets the needs of CAN system developers through to service technicians.
With an intelligent LED that displays bus loads and error frames, an industry-leading IP67 rating and an innovative connector system, the U100 has numerous stand-out features. Fully compatible with J1939, CANopen, NMEA 2000® and DeviceNet, this suits rugged and higher voltage applications in marine, industrial, construction, heavy-duty, agriculture and automotive, including electric vehicle markets.
With enhanced protection of its own electrical circuits, a vibration, shock and drop-proof housing and high-quality cabling, the Kvaser U100 establishes a new reference in CAN interface design. At the same time, the U100 promises to drive down cost of ownership, whilst providing additional revenue opportunities for partners.
Major Features
USB CAN interface.
Powered through the USB connector.
Supports CAN FD, up to 8 Mbit/s (with correct physical layer implementation).
Supports both 11-bit (CAN 2.0A) and 29-bit (CAN 2.0B active) identifiers.
Lightweight robust housing made of glass fibre reinforced polyamide overmolded with TPE.
Intuitive LED UI.
Reinforced galvanic isolation, design validated with 5000 VAC rms applied for 60 s.
Industrial grade temperature range, −40 â—¦C to 85 â—¦C.
20 000 msg/s, each timestamped with a resolution of 100 μs.
Fully compatible with applications written for other Kvaser CAN hardware with Kvaser CANlib.
Support for SocketCAN.
Fully compatible with J1939, CANopen, NMEA 2000 and DeviceNet.
IP67 rated housing.
Software
Documentation, software and drivers can be downloaded for free at www.kvaser.com/downloads.
Kvaser CANLIB SDK is a free resource that includes everything you need to develop software for the Kvaser CAN interfaces. Includes full documentation and many program samples, written in C, C , C#, Delphi, and Visual Basic.
All Kvaser CAN interface boards share a common software API. Programs written for one interface type will run without modifications on the other interface types!
Windows drivers for all our CAN hardware. Please check the release notes for information on which Windows versions are supported. The package also contains a driver for a virtual CAN bus, for testing and evaluation when you don't have access to a physical CAN bus.
Software development kit - everything you need to develop software for the Kvaser CAN and LIN interfaces. Libraries, header files, sample programs for e.g. C, C , C#, Visual Basic and Delphi, documentation, and more. Note: you need to download and install the appropriate device drivers separately.